If you have a negative scanner then you can save a bit of money buy getting the negatives developed but not printed, scaning the negatives and deciding off the scan which ones you would like to print. however most labs will charge you the higher reprint price if you hand them an already developed negative. you have to decide how many images you are likely to want prints of from each negative and then do the math based on the prices at your prefered developer.
